28 August 2026, 11:25  Italy: Industrial Sales Decline in June.

Italy’s industrial turnover dropped 1.0% month-on-month in June 2026, reversing a downwardly revised 0.5% rise in the previous month. Sales declined in both domestic (-1% vs 0.1% in May) and foreign (-1% vs 1.3%) markets. On an annual basis, industrial turnover, adjusted for calendar effects, rose 3.1%, slowing from a downwardly revised 5.2% increase in May, as growth moderated in both domestic (2.3% vs 4.7%) and foreign (4.6% vs 6.2%) sales. By industrial group, turnover declined only for consumer goods (-1.2%), while energy (22.2%), intermediate goods (5.4%) and capital goods (0.8%) recorded increases. Meanwhile, turnover in the services sector showed no change compared to the previous month, following a 0.2% rise in May. In the second quarter, seasonally adjusted industrial turnover increased 1.2%.
